ITEM - 4    DEVELOPMENT APPLICATION 2014/74 ADDITIONS AND ALTERATIONS ON LOT 122 DP 661228 LOFTUS STREET, EUGOWRA

 

Proceedings in Brief

The Senior Town Planner explained that the applicant seeks to vary Council’s development standards by a total of 25mm only,  to achieve a consistent level throughout the house without having to construct the additions elevated from the original dwelling.

 

Motion (Culverson/Davison)

 

THAT:

 

1.   Council grant consent to vary the Building Alignment Policy and DCP No 16 Flood Prone Land in Eugowra. Clause 3.3 relating to minimum freeboard level.

 

2.   Council approve Development Application 2014/74 for additions and alterations on Lot 122 DP 661228 Loftus Street, Eugowra subject to the attached conditions. 

 

ESS65/13

Carried

 

The Chair called for a Division of Council as required under Section 375A (3) of the Local Government Act which resulted in a unanimous vote for the motion (noting the absence of Clrs MacSmith and Wilcox – apologies).

 

 

 

ITEM - 5    HERITAGE GRANTS 2013/14 PROGRAM

 

Proceedings in Brief

The General Manager requested an amendment to the wording of the recommendations to remove the names of the individuals so that the Churches are funded directly.  

 

Recommendation (Durkin/Davison)

 

THAT:

 

1)   The application to improve drainage and stabilise foundations at the St John’s Church, 6 Hamilton Street, Cargo be supported and that a funding offer of $2,000 be made, subject to complying with the recommendations of the heritage advisor.

 

2)   The application to improve drainage at St James Church, Wall Street, Cudal be supported and that a funding offer of $1,500 be made, subject to complying with the recommendations of the heritage advisor.

 

ESS66/13

Carried
